Re: 64bit: invalid ltdl library


On 2013-04-25 23:35, Peter Rosin wrote:
> On 2013-04-25 22:07, marco atzeri wrote:
>> any idea ?
>>
>> configure:21346: checking for lt_dladvise_preload in -lltdl
>> configure:21371: gcc -std=gnu99 -std=gnu99 -o conftest.exe  -fopenmp -ggdb -O2 -pipe -fdebug-prefix-map=/pub/devel/imagemagick/ImageMagick-6.7.6.3-3/build=/usr/src/debug/ImageMagick-6.7.6.3-3 -fdebug-prefix-map=/pub/devel/imagemagick/ImageMagick-6.7.6.3-3/src/ImageMagick-6.7.6-3=/usr/src/debug/ImageMagick-6.7.6.3-3 -Wall    conftest.c -lltdl    >&5
>> configure:21371: $? = 0
>> configure:21380: result: yes
>> configure:21427: error: invalid ltdl library directory: `/usr/lib'
>>
>>
>> $ ls -l /usr/lib/*ltd*
>> -rw-r--r-- 1 marco None 199770 Mar 31 07:14 /usr/lib/libltdl.a
>> -rwxr-xr-x 1 marco None  41902 Mar 31 07:14 /usr/lib/libltdl.dll.a
>>
>> $ file /usr/lib/libltdl.dll.a
>> /usr/lib/libltdl.dll.a: current ar archive
>>
>> Regards
>> Marco
> 
> My guess is that cygport has been a bit too aggressive w/o the libtool
> maintainer (or whoever build the 64-bit libtool package) noticing and

s/build/built/

> that /usr/lib/libltdl.la has been inadvertently stripped out of the
> libtool package.

You can probably workaround that by copying the libltdl.la file from a
32-bit install. They are probably exactly equal.
